WebMar 19, 2024 · A minority shareholder’s marginal voting position can unfairly empower other shareholders, especially if they vote together. If a minority shareholder is successful in showing he or she is entitled to a buyout under these laws, the company can be forced to pay the “fair value” of a minority owner’s shares. WebGenerally, appraisal rights are a minority shareholder’s exclusive remedy to obtain a fair buyout—that is, minority shareholders cannot ordinarily challenge or attack the corporation’s proposed merger. An exception to this rule applies when one party to the merger is directly or indirectly controlled by, or under common control with ...
